The Sustainable Groundwater Management Act (SGMA) requires certain groundwater basin areas to form a Groundwater Sustainability Agency (GSA) by June 2017, and once approved by California Department of Water Resources, draft a Groundwater Sustainability Plan (GSP).

The San Antonio Basin GSA (SABGSA) is formed by a joint powers authority between Cachmua Resource Conservation District and the Los Alamos Community Services District. During the development the GSA working group was comprised of: the County Water Agency, Los Alamos Community Services District (LACSD), Vandenberg Air Force Base (VAFB), and the Cachuma Resources Conservation District (CRCD).

More information about the San Antonio Basin GSA can be found on their website: http://sanantoniobasingsa.org/

Note: The San Antonio Basin Groundwater Sustainability Agency described here is different from the San Antonio Groundwater Basin Study.
